  • Celebrity mementos auction Wednesday, October 6, 2010 @ 7:34PMNEW YORK - UNRELEASED Lady Gaga songs, handwritten Paul McCartney lyrics and clothing from Princess Diana and Elvis Presley are among unique celebrity items that will be sold in an online auction this month. McCartney's handwritten working lyrics to 'Maxwell's Silver Hammer' from the 1969 Abbey Road album are expected to be the top seller with a price tag of at least US$200,000 (S$261,691).

  • Jackson Moonwalk Glove Sells For $350K In NYC Saturday, November 21, 2009 @ 7:39PMThe iconic glove Michael Jackson wore when he premiered his trademark moonwalk in 1983 has been auctioned off for $350,000. As the glove's price soared on Saturday, fans roared and squealed with pleasure -- echoing the kind of frenzy that accompanied the late pop star on his tours. The left-hand, rhinestone-studded white glove Jackson wore for his moonwalk on Motown's 25th anniversary TV special ...
